ABOUT AAIC 2026

Advancing Brain Health Through Research, Education & Collaboration At AAIC 2026

Connecting the Global Alzheimer's & Dementia Research Community

The Alzheimer's Association International Conference (AAIC) 2026 brings together researchers, clinicians, healthcare professionals, academics, and industry leaders from around the world. The event provides a platform for scientific exchange, professional learning, and collaboration focused on Alzheimer's disease, dementia, neuroscience, cognitive health, and emerging developments in brain research.

Scientific Sessions & Educational Programs

Explore keynote presentations, research findings, interactive workshops, panel discussions, and expert-led educational sessions covering current topics in dementia research, neuroscience, clinical care, and brain health.

International Collaboration & Networking

AAIC 2026 provides opportunities to connect with professionals from diverse disciplines and regions, encouraging knowledge sharing, collaborative discussions, and valuable professional networking throughout the event.

A Diverse Global Professional Community

The conference welcomes researchers, clinicians, educators, healthcare practitioners, students, and industry representatives who are committed to advancing understanding and innovation in Alzheimer's disease and brain health.
